Introduction to ERP Software in Logistics

ERP software serves as a central hub for managing and automating the complex processes of logistics and freight forwarding. It integrates diverse functions, including inventory control, transportation management, and customer interactions, into a cohesive system.

Modern logistics demands seamless coordination, real-time data access, and error-free operations—capabilities that ERP systems excel in delivering. With the ever-growing market demand for efficient supply chain solutions, the adoption of ERP software has become a necessity, not just an option.

Core Features of ERP Software for Logistics

A logistics-oriented ERP system should include these essential features:

  1. Inventory and Warehouse Management
    Track inventory levels, manage stock replenishment, and optimize warehouse space usage.
  2. Transportation and Fleet Management
    Plan routes, monitor vehicle performance, and ensure timely deliveries.
  3. Real-Time Tracking Capabilities
    Provide visibility into shipments, enabling proactive decision-making and customer updates.
  4. Customer Relationship Management (CRM)
    Enhance client interactions by streamlining communication and maintaining detailed customer histories.

Benefits of ERP Software for Freight Forwarders

Adopting an ERP system offers numerous advantages, such as:

  • Enhanced Operational Efficiency: Automate repetitive tasks and reduce manual errors.
  • Improved Accuracy: Minimize mistakes in invoicing, routing, and documentation.
  • Better Customer Service: Deliver accurate, timely updates to clients.
  • Data Centralization: Access all operational data from a single platform.

Types of ERP Software for Logistics and Freight Forwarding

Understanding the different deployment options is key to making an informed choice:

  • On-Premise ERP: Installed on local servers, offering greater control.
  • Cloud-Based ERP: Provides flexibility and remote access.
  • Hybrid Solutions: Combine the strengths of both on-premise and cloud systems.

FAQs About ERP Software for Logistics and Freight Forwarding

  • What is the average cost of ERP software for logistics?

Costs vary widely but typically range from $10,000 to $500,000, depending on features and scale.

  • How long does it take to implement an ERP system?

Implementation timelines can range from 6 months to 2 years.

  • Can ERP systems integrate with TMS and WMS?

Yes, most modern ERPs support seamless integration with these systems.
